    Earthy Boho Palette: Paint & Decor That Feel Warm & Relaxed

    Published: Sep 11, 2026 by Meg · This post may contain affiliate links ·

    Create a relaxed boho-inspired home with warm earthy paint colors, natural textures, and cozy decor that feels collected and calm.

    Earthy boho style is all about warmth and texture. Focus on layered neutrals, clay tones, and organic materials to create a warm, relaxed home.

    Natural fibers and vintage-inspired pieces keep the vibe relaxed without feeling messy. The goal is cozy and curated — not cluttered.

    Paint Colors for an Earthy Boho Home

    • Casa Blanca – creamy warm white
    • Cavern Clay – earthy terracotta accent
    • Accessible Beige – grounded neutral backdrop
    • Evergreen Fog – muted earthy green.

    💡 Tip: These tones transition beautifully between rooms, making them perfect for an open layout or whole-home palette.

    How to Bring the Look Together

    The key to an earthy boho home is layering natural textures and neutral tones with a hint of clay. Neutral walls provide the perfect backdrop for all of the earthy boho details: a rattan light fixture, cane dining chairs, or a clay vase.

    Let the textures do the talking while providing the contrast that makes a room look put together. A soft vintage rug near a rattan light fixture; a slipcovered couch next to a terracotta vase.

    Decor Inspiration

    Here are a few pieces that capture the earthy boho vibe perfectly:

    • Rattan pendant lighting — warm texture overhead
    • Vintage-inspired patterned rug — adds color and softness
    • Linen bedding or slipcovered furniture — relaxed and organic
    • Clay or terracotta vases — earthy layered detail
    • Cane or woven accent furniture — natural boho texture.

    Stick with a mix of organic materials and soft, earthy colors for a peaceful, elevated look that still feels comfortable.

    Why This Palette Works

    Warm neutrals and earthy accents create a relaxed bohemian look that feels cozy instead of chaotic.

    The various textures come together to create a cohesive look, while the natural materials keep the palette grounded and timeless.
